You may recall Mega Evolutions, the highly dramatic, flashy, and shamelessly entertaining super moves brought about by Game Freak around the time of Pokeómon X and Y. To activate them, the player must simply select the option to Mega Evolve during battle, and assuming the associated "Mega Stone" that correlates with the given Pokeómon is currently held, the monster will transform before your eyes into a hulking, formidable version of itself, ready to wreak havoc and deal out vast amounts of damage. The adjustments vary, but generally speaking a mega-evolved ‘mon has a cumulative base stats total of 100 points higher than normal. Perusing sites like Bulbapedia sheds further light on the elusive technical details.
Pokeómon Sun and Moon has been available now for some time, but a headline today caught my attention and ultimately left me scratching my head. A variety of Mega Stones not previously obtainable in Pokeómon Sun and Moon are being made available to download, for players itching to Mega Evolve certain creatures they were previously unable to. The odd part about this is that Mega Evolution itself was de-emphasized in Sun and Moon after its introduction the generation prior, but some Mega Stones were still obtainable in-game, just not all of them. Also, held items don’t transfer when using Pokeómon Bank, meaning transferring monsters specifically groomed or mathed-out for the their mega forms in particular isn't exactly worthwhile, especially if the correlating stone isn't available.
